“Once Bruce and I got together, I wanted to have a real relationship that was going to create a family and a beautiful, emotional environment. “You can’t do it all, whatever it is,” she says. Although the record received rave reviews, she wasn’t willing to fully promote it by touring or traveling because she faced the prospect of having three children in diapers. In 1993, she released her debut solo CD, Rumble Doll, when she was six months pregnant with her third child. We don’t book anything until we go over the kids’ schedules and make sure we are home for the plays and things like that.” “To really say, ‘Look, the kids come first,’ and get it out on the table is important when the decisions come along, like when we’ll tour. “Bruce and I set the first priority in the children,” says Scialfa of sons Evan, 14, and Sam, 10, and daughter Jessica, 12. The two fell in love and married in 1991, and her solo career took a backseat to her marriage and family. Three years later, she was offered a solo record deal, but Springsteen called and asked her to join his upcoming tour. In the 1980s, she recorded or performed with the Rolling Stones, Southside Johnny & the Asbury Jukes, and Buster Poindexter before joining Springsteen’s E Street Band in 1984.

Scialfa (pronounced SKAL-fah) remains one of the most respected women in music for her folk-rock influenced singing, writing and guitar-playing. Scialfa, 51, considered the first lady of rock ’n’ roll because she’s married to music legend Bruce Springsteen, follows the philosophy of another first lady, the late Jacqueline Kennedy, who once said, “If you bungle raising your children, I don’t think whatever else you do well matters very much.” Rock singer Patti Scialfa could have been a household name, but she decided to be a good mother instead.
